A Real Sliding Doors Moment

Motorized solutions are becoming much more common in today’s smart homes. Although remotely controlled motorized garage door openers were invented in the 1930s, only recently have they became “smart” and integrated into an overall smart home. For example, the Tailwind iQ3 Smart Automatic Garage Controller uses sensors in your cars to automatically open/close your garage doors when you drive up to your home or drive away. It also integrates with a wide range of smart home platforms.

Motorized window coverings, including shades, curtains, and drapes, have become more prevalent in smart homes. Initially, motorized window coverings were controlled through wall switches or proprietary remote controls. Now, there are many models that leverage wireless smart home protocols for integration with an overall smart home solution.

Automating windows allows for improved ventilation in a home. When coupled with a smart weather station, windows can be opened when the outside temperature and humidity won’t impact the comfort of people in the home. Fresh, outside air can be leveraged for ventilation and improved indoor air quality (IAQ). The smart weather station can also be leveraged to sense when it is raining and automatically close the windows in a home to avoid water damage.

Newer to this collection of motorization offerings for the smart home is LycheeThings, which offers SmartSlydr, a 2023 CES Innovation Award-winning solution for opening/closing sliding glass doors and sliding windows. The motorized SmartSlydr product was released through Indiegogo in 2021 and is now sold through the LycheeThings website.
